Matthiola fragrans - an annual aromatic plant, 30–50 cm tall. Flowers are small, 1.5–2 cm in diameter, lilac-purple in color. During blooming, they release a strong and pleasant fragrance. Used for decorating flower beds, rock gardens, balcony boxes, and garden vases.
Fragrant matthiola is a cold-resistant annual plant valued for its evening scent and easy care. Grown in open ground, on balconies, and in containers. Prefers sunny or slightly shaded areas with loose, moderately fertile soil. In autumn, dig the soil with added humus; in spring — loosen and level the surface. Sow in early spring directly into the ground when temperatures reach +10…+12 °C. Seed depth — 0.5–1 cm, row spacing — 20–30 cm.
Care includes regular loosening, weeding, moderate watering without overwatering, and feeding with balanced fertilizers. Matthiola does not require transplanting and tolerates short-term frosts well. Flowering begins 40–50 days after germination and lasts until late summer. Flowers open in the evening and release a strong pleasant aroma. Propagated by seeds; repeat sowings can extend the flowering period.
